Hero Mavrick 440

Hero Mavrick 440 is a 440cc cruiser bike with price starting from Rs. 1.99 lakh. It is available in 5 colours and 3 variants. The bike gets disc brakes in the front and rear, apart from this it weighs 187 kg and has a fuel tank capacity of 13.5 liters. Mavrick 440 is a tough competitor to Bajaj Dominar 400, Bajaj Pulsar NS400Z and Harley Davidson X440 .

Pros and Cons of Mavrick 440

Likes

  • Torquey and refined engine
  • Handling is engaging
  • Very light clutch action
  • Even base variant gets Bluetooth connectivity & turn-by-turn navigation
  • Very competitively priced
  • Very comfortable for even two-up riding

Dislikes

  • Finish levels can still improve
  • Neo-retro design isn’t unique and won’t grab much attention
  • Console’s space could’ve been utilized better

Expert's Conclusion

The Hero Mavrick 440 is a bike that’s well priced, is easy to ride in the city and will handle your occasional highway jaunts as well, all in a slightly more sporty manner than the Royal Enfield Hunter 350. The one issue is that it doesn’t feel as special as its rivals like the Hunter 350, Triumph Speed 400, Harley-Davidson X440 and the Classic 350 do

Hero Mavrick 440 Key Highlights

Price: The Hero Mavrick 440 is offered in three variants: Base, Mid, and Top. These are priced at Rs 1,99,000, Rs 2,14,000, and Rs 2,24,000, respectively (ex-showroom, Delhi).

Design: The Hero Mavrick 440 has a neo-retro styling. The bike manages to look premium with all its colour options. Hero has taken a very conservative approach with its styling, which makes the Mavrick’s design easy to appreciate for a wide variety of people.

Features: Hero Mavrick 440 gets LED lighting, a digital instrument cluster with smartphone connectivity for phone alerts and turn-by-turn navigation. The top-end variant also gets e-sim connectivity of network based features like geo-fencing, vehicle diagnostics, location sharing, vehicle tracking, and more.

Engine: Hero Mavrick 440 is powered by an air and oil-cooled 440cc single-cylinder engine that makes 27.36PS at 6,000rpm and 36Nm at 4,000rpm. It gets a 6-speed gearbox with a slipper clutch.

Suspension, Brakes & Other Details: The Mavrick 440 has a 43mm telescopic fork and a 7-step preload-adjustable twin-shocks. It has 17-inch wheels on both ends – spoked on the base variant, and alloys on the other two. It has a 110-section front tyre and a 150-section rear tyre. The front wheel has a 320mm disc brake while the rear has a 240mm disc brake, with dual-channel ABS. The Mavrick has a 13.5-litre fuel tank, an 803mm seat height, and 175mm ground clearance.

Rivals: The Mavrick 440 rivals the Royal Enfield Classic 350, Honda CB350, Jawa 350, and its American sibling, the Harley-Davidson X440.

Variants: There are three variants of the Mavrick – Base, Mid, and Top. The base variant gets spoked wheels, and is available only in Arctic White paint scheme. The mid variant gets alloys, tubeless tyres, and can be had in either Celestial Blue or Fearless Red paint scheme. The top variant has diamond-cut alloy wheels, machined engine fins, e-sim connectivity, 3D badges, tubeless tyres, and is available in Phantom Black and Enigma Black paint schemes.

Hero Mavrick 440 Colours

Hero Mavrick 440 bike is available in 5 exciting colours options like Phantom Black, Enigma Black, Fearless Red, Celestial Blue and Arctic White.
